Description

7,7,8,8-Tetradeuteriodocosanoic Acid is a deuterium-labeled derivative of behenic acid, a long-chain saturated fatty acid. This stable isotope-labeled compound is essential for advanced analytical research, providing a non-radioactive tracer with distinct mass spectral properties. It is primarily utilized by researchers and scientists in pharmaceutical development, metabolic studies, and lipid biochemistry who require precise internal standards for mass spectrometry.

Application

  • Mass Spectrometry Internal Standard: Serves as a critical quantitative reference standard in GC-MS and LC-MS analyses for behenic acid and related lipids.
  • Metabolic Pathway Tracing: Used in deuterium labeling studies to investigate fatty acid metabolism, absorption, and β-oxidation in biological systems.
  • Pharmaceutical Research: Employed in the development and validation of analytical methods for lipid-based drug formulations and pharmacokinetic studies.
  • Biochemical Research: Acts as a probe in enzymatic studies involving fatty acid synthesis, elongation, or degradation pathways.
  • Nutritional Science: Facilitates the accurate quantification of behenic acid in complex matrices like food products, oils, and biological fluids.
  • Stable Isotope Labeling: Provides a building block for synthesizing more complex deuterium-labeled compounds for specialized research applications.

Basic Information

Product Name 7,7,8,8-Tetradeuteriodocosanoic Acid
CAS No. 1193721-65-1
Molecular Formula C22D4H40O2
Molecular Weight 344.62 g/mol
Synonyms Docosanoic-7,7,8,8-d4 Acid; Behenic-d4 Acid; n-Docosanoic-d4 Acid; 7,7,8,8-Tetradeuteriobrassylic Acid; Deuterated Behenic Acid; C22:0-d4; [7,7,8,8-2H4]Docosanoic Acid
